
Studying Python in 2025: A Recent Begin
Are you able to take your abilities to the subsequent degree? Studying Python in 2025: A Recent Begin is your alternative to embrace one of the crucial versatile and in-demand programming languages, even in the event you’ve by no means tried it earlier than. Think about opening new profession doorways, constructing modern initiatives, or just sharpening your technical toolkit—all with the facility of Python. By the point you end studying this information, you’ll really feel impressed to dive in with readability and confidence. Python is the right language for each newbies and seasoned professionals, and beginning contemporary in 2025 has by no means been extra thrilling!
Additionally Learn: Actual-world purposes of synthetic intelligence in internet design.
Why Python is Nonetheless Related in 2025
Python has constantly topped the charts as one of the crucial common and versatile programming languages, and it exhibits no indicators of slowing down in 2025. Its easy syntax, broad software throughout industries, and energetic neighborhood assist have made Python a go-to language for builders, information scientists, and engineers internationally.
Professionals use Python in every part from synthetic intelligence to internet growth, machine studying, automation, and past. The language’s adaptability ensures that whether or not you’re a hobbyist or aiming for advanced-level initiatives, Python continues to supply immense worth. With tech forecasted to develop exponentially within the coming years, Python maintains its place as a robust basis for anybody trying to make an affect in expertise.
Additionally Learn: How Lengthy Does It Take To Study Python
The Advantages of Beginning Python from Scratch
Even when you have dabbled in Python previously, 2025 is a perfect time to begin contemporary. Applied sciences evolve quickly, and Python is not any exception. New instruments, frameworks, and greatest practices emerge yearly, making it price revisiting the language to equip your self with probably the most up to date approaches.
Ranging from scratch allows you to undertake trendy methodologies like writing cleaner code with Python 3.10+ syntax or using new libraries designed for environment friendly application-building. For newbies, diving into Python in 2025 ensures that you simply’re studying with up-to-date assets, loads of community-driven tutorials, and an industry-wide demand ready on your abilities.
What You Have to Begin Studying Python in 2025
Earlier than beginning your Python journey, it’s important to arrange the best setting and instruments. Don’t let the setup course of intimidate you—beginning with Python is less complicated than ever in 2025!
1. A Dependable Code Editor
Choosing the proper programming instruments is important. The excellent news is that there are many dependable code editors accessible to get began. Visible Studio Code, PyCharm, and Jupyter Pocket book stay common decisions amongst Python builders. These editors are user-friendly, and plenty of combine options corresponding to debugging, syntax highlighting, and pre-configured extensions particularly for Python coding.
2. Your Python Set up
Putting in Python is the next step. Python.org all the time gives the newest model of the interpreter, and it takes only a few clicks to obtain it on your working system. In 2025, variations past Python 3.10 are optimized with even cleaner syntax and up to date functionalities, supplying you with a smoother coding expertise. Make sure to make the most of a digital setting like “venv” to maintain your initiatives organized and dependencies separated.
3. Sturdy Studying Assets
Supplementing your journey with high quality assets makes all of the distinction. Make the most of on-line environments like Codecademy, freeCodeCamp, and LinkedIn Studying programs that cater to all expertise ranges. Python neighborhood boards like Stack Overflow and Reddit stay energetic hubs for troubleshooting and studying.
4. A Clear Studying Technique
To succeed, construction your objectives. A step-by-step framework will hold you targeted. Start with understanding the fundamentals like variables, information varieties, and operators. Make your method to intermediate ideas like object-oriented programming. Lastly, pursue specialization areas corresponding to information evaluation or internet growth primarily based in your profession aspirations.
Additionally Learn: High 10 Synthetic Intelligence Books for Newbies
Rising Tendencies Driving Python’s Recognition
Python’s attraction in 2025 is additional bolstered by its integration into cutting-edge applied sciences. As industries more and more embrace digital transformation, Python serves as a bridge to modern options. Studying this language opens doorways to a few of the fastest-growing domains right now.
Synthetic Intelligence and Machine Studying
The AI revolution is right here, and Python stays the dominant language on this house. Libraries corresponding to TensorFlow, PyTorch, and scikit-learn simplify implementing machine studying fashions. Each newbies and consultants use Python for duties like predictive analytics, advice engines, and AI initiatives.
Information Science and Analytics
Python is a cornerstone in information science workflows. Analysts depend on its libraries like pandas, NumPy, and Matplotlib for every part from information processing to visualization. Python additionally integrates seamlessly with instruments like Jupyter Notebooks, making information storytelling not solely intuitive however impactful. Coaching in Python data-related libraries is a should for anybody curious about processing large-scale datasets in 2025.
Internet and App Improvement
If constructing purposes excites you, Python frameworks corresponding to Flask and Django make internet growth an thrilling space to discover. Builders can effectively design safe and scalable internet apps utilizing Python. The expertise is future-proof and dominates industries like e-commerce, healthcare, and finance.
Additionally Learn: Spyce – The infinite robotic kitchen
Troubleshooting Frequent Challenges for Python Newbies
Whereas studying Python has a low barrier to entry, everybody faces hurdles. It’s essential to view challenges as alternatives to construct resilience. The secret’s to troubleshoot successfully and stay constant in your efforts.
Understanding Errors
Each programmer encounters errors, particularly newbies. Syntax errors and logical errors may be irritating, however don’t allow them to discourage you. The Python interpreter gives detailed error messages; use them to pinpoint and proper points. Make debugging a part of your development; the extra you apply, the better it turns into to wash code.
Discovering Time to Apply
Constructing a constant apply schedule is important. Python studying doesn’t require hours of examine every single day—quick, common classes are sometimes simpler. Even half-hour of each day apply builds long-lasting habits over time.
Looking for Assist When Caught
Python’s intensive neighborhood means assistance is all the time across the nook. Whether or not you submit questions on Stack Overflow or be a part of native coding meetups, connecting with others can speed up your studying course of. Collaboration encourages problem-solving from contemporary views.
Additionally Learn: The Finest Free AI instruments on the Internet
Keep Motivated Whereas Studying Python
Studying Python in 2025 isn’t nearly writing code; it’s about constructing a mindset for problem-solving and creativity. Staying motivated is the important thing to creating constant progress.
Work on Actual-World Initiatives
Have interaction in small, sensible initiatives like constructing a climate app or a private financial savings calculator. These initiatives enable you apply what you’ve realized and hold the joy alive. Over time, transfer on to collaborative initiatives or open-source contributions, which is able to improve your portfolio.
Observe Your Progress
As you be taught Python, constantly measure your progress. Maintain a journal of ideas mastered, capabilities realized, and initiatives accomplished. Instruments like GitHub can function digital repositories, showcasing how far you’ve come and motivating you to succeed in better milestones.
Have fun Your Wins
Don’t overlook to rejoice your achievements, nonetheless small they could appear. Every step ahead is an indicator of progress. Finishing your first program, fixing a difficult bug, or mastering a difficult idea are all moments price celebrating as milestones in your studying journey.
Your Path Ahead
In 2025, beginning contemporary with Python presents each immense alternatives and the instruments wanted to realize success. As an accessible language with limitless purposes, Python transforms concepts into prospects. Whether or not you’re pursuing a profession in information science, AI, or internet growth, the abilities you achieve translate into tangible outcomes.